How to View the State of Members of an Operations Manager 2007 Group

Applies To: Operations Manager 2007 R2, Operations Manager 2007 SP1

Use the following procedure to view the state of members of an Operations Manager 2007 group.

To view the state of members of an Operations Manager 2007 group

  1. Log on to the computer with an account that is a member of the Operations Manager Authors role for the Operations Manager 2007 management group.

  2. In the Operations console, click the Authoring button.

  3. In the Navigation pane, expand Authoring, and then click Groups.

  4. In the Groups pane, right-click the group for which you want to view the state of members, and then click View group state to display the state of the members of the group.

    Note

    If you have a large deployment, there might be a delay between the time a new group is created and when its state is calculated. Until rollup configuration is calculated, the state will be displayed as unmonitored (white icon).

    The state of an object will be Unknown if the management pack for the object, such as Microsoft SQL Server 2005, has not been imported into the management group.
